Book Synopsis The Wild Girls Club by : Anka Radakovich

Download or read book The Wild Girls Club written by Anka Radakovich and published by . This book was released on 1995-05 with total page 231 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A lightweight guide to sexuality with the emphasis on an analysis of contemporary myths about sexual prowess and anatomical details. Chapters deal with issues such as testosterone, sexology and facts of life. The final chapter deals with answering the question about male bonding.
